Details about the neuroanatomical projections from ACB to SI

To view more data and metadata associated with each report, click on its ID.

Report IDSending structure Receiving structureProjection strengthTechniqueGeneral description projectionCollatorAssociated reference
94500 Nucleus accumbensSubstantia innominata very strongautoradiography
Sections immediately posterior to the injection site show several heavily labeled, caudo-ventrally oriented fiber bundles most of which, about 1.5 mm farther caudally, pass below the anterior commissure into the dorsal part of the substantia innominata (F
Nauta W.J., Smith G.P., Faull R.L. & Domesick V.B., 1978
94520 Nucleus accumbensSubstantia innominata strongautoradiography
Collator note: a conspicuous and strong field in the dorsomedial corner of the SI, caudally. See Fig. 1D, Swanson Atlas Levels 22-23.
Nauta W.J., Smith G.P., Faull R.L. & Domesick V.B., 1978
General description technique/protocol: Collator note: case RR 86, injection with tritiated aminoacids in the rostro-medial ACB, mapped here onto Swanson Atlas Levels 12-13. The halo of the injection may extend minimally in the ventral CP, if any.
